Superbeast is a horror and science fiction movie that came out in 1972. This film tells the story of a doctor who stumbles upon a jungle laboratory teeming with strange genetic experiments and a mad scientist. Key performers in the movie are Antoinette Bower, Craig Littler, and Harry Lauter. This article gives insight into where the film got shot and interesting backstage facts.

Where it Filmed?

The movie was filmed in the beautiful landscapes of the Philippines. Unfortunately, specific filming dates are not available. The jungle-like environment of the Philippines provided the perfect backdrop for this sci-fi horror movie with its narrative based around a jungle laboratory.

Trivia and Facts

  • The film was released by United Artists on November 1, 1972, as a double feature with Daughters of Satan.
  • The movie featured in the documentary Premiere: The Manster/Terror Is a Man/Superbeast in 1992.
  • The film had a modest budget of approximately $275,000.
